Understanding Your BMW Key Type
BMW has produced numerous generations of key innovation for many years, and determining which type you own will considerably affect your replacement procedure and expenses. The earliest BMW keys were easy mechanical blades that needed no programming whatsoever. These uncomplicated gadgets could be replicated at a lot of hardware stores or locksmiths for very little expense, though vehicles from this age have actually mainly aged out of active usage.
The shift to transponder keys brought electronic elements into the equation. These keys contain a little chip that communicates with your BMW's engine control unit, verifying that the right key is present before the lorry will start. BMW presented these type in the late 1990s, and they remained standard through the early 2000s. Replacement needs both cutting the mechanical blade and configuring the transponder chip to match your particular car's security system.
Modern BMW vehicles use what the business calls "Comfort Access" or "Smart Key" innovation. These proximity-based systems permit you to unlock and start your vehicle without ever removing the secret from your pocket. The key includes advanced electronic devices, numerous security protocols, and in some cases even miniature batteries that power extra features like keyless entry. The expense and intricacy of changing these keys shows their advanced nature, with shows needing specialized dealership equipment and security confirmation treatments.

The Replacement Process Explained
Acquiring a replacement BMW crucial involves a number of steps developed to validate your identity and secure versus lorry theft. The first requirement is showing ownership of the car. Car dealerships and most locksmith professionals will ask for government-issued recognition, such as a motorist's license, along with paperwork showing you are the registered owner of the BMW. Car registration files serve this function successfully.
For automobiles with older crucial systems, the locksmith professional or dealer might simply need to cut a brand-new crucial blade to match your ignition cylinder. The transponder chip, if present, requires programs utilizing specialized equipment that checks out and writes to the car's security memory. This process normally takes less than an hour for knowledgeable professionals dealing with familiar car designs.
Newer BMW automobiles with Comfort Access systems require more substantial treatments. The replacement secret need to be "married" to your car through BMW's diagnostic and shows systems, which are mostly exclusive to car dealership service departments. This process develops interaction in between the key and all lorry modules, guaranteeing proper function of distance detection, push-button start, and any extra features your particular crucial setup includes.
Expense Considerations and Factors
The cost you'll spend for a replacement BMW crucial depends greatly on your car's age and crucial technology. Fundamental transponder keys for BMW vehicles from the 2000s usually expense between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 when obtained through aftermarket sources, though dealer rates frequently run higher. These keys need professional cutting and programming, adding labor expenses to the parts expense.
Comfort Access keys and the most recent "Display Key" versions with integrated touchscreens represent the premium tier of BMW key innovation. Dealership costs for these advanced gadgets regularly exceed ₤ 400, and in some cases approach ₤ 600 when all associated shows and verification costs are consisted of. The Display Key, readily available on choose BMW models, works as both a key and a push-button control, displaying automobile status information and making it possible for different convenience functions.
Labor expenses differ substantially between companies. Dealership service departments usually costs at higher hourly rates than independent locksmiths, though they use brand-specific know-how and genuine OEM parts. Your location likewise influences pricing, as metropolitan locations with greater operating expense often see elevated rates for both parts and labor. Getting quotes from several sources before dedicating to a replacement can yield meaningful savings.

Often Asked Questions
Can I get a replacement BMW key without going to the dealer?
Yes, numerous locksmith professionals provide BMW key replacement services, particularly for lorries produced before 2015. However, BMW Keys with sophisticated Comfort Access systems may require car dealership programs equipment. Verify the locksmith's abilities and your vehicle's compatibility before scheduling service.
The length of time does BMW key replacement take?
Dealers usually require one to 3 company days to obtain and program a replacement secret, though many keep typical key enters stock for same-day service. Independent locksmith professionals typically complete fundamental transponder crucial replacements within an hour, while complex wise crucial shows might need numerous hours or a follow-up appointment.
Will my insurance cover a lost BMW secret?
Extensive auto insurance plan typically cover crucial replacement, subject to your deductible. In addition, some roadside support programs and credit card benefits include essential replacement coverage. BMW Spare Key or call your insurance coverage agent to comprehend your specific coverage.
Can I configure a BMW crucial myself?
Early BMW transponder keys can in some cases be self-programmed utilizing series of ignition cycles and button presses, though the procedure differs by design year and outcomes are inconsistent. Newer Comfort Access keys require manufacturer-specific shows equipment that customers can not access, making expert service necessary.
